Product Description 60-minute audio cassette featuring 3 classic horror stories, read by actor Earl Hammond: "The Tell-Tale Heart," "The Cask of Amontillado," and "The Black Cat," plus paperback edition of Poe’s The Gold-Bug and Other Tales, a collection of 9 stories, including three on cassette, plus "The Fall of the House of Usher," "The Murders in the Rue Morgue," the title tale and 3 others. From AudioFile Dover Books has entered the audio publishing market with book-and-cassette programs. A single cassette ranging from 45 to 90 minutes long is combined with a Dover Thrift Classics edition of the accompanying book. These are among the most interesting, inexpensive products recently released. Dover's visibility is also an asset to attracting new listeners with these audiobooks. Adult new readers, as well as young readers, will find these audios very approachable. The Andersen and Burgess stories are nicely read with clarity and emphasis akin to a favored adult sharing a story. The intended audience will find them appealing. Earl Hammond uses a sinister voice for Poe's "Heart" and takes on exaggerated characterizations with success in the other stories. The sound quality is generally good though not quite top-notch. Nevertheless, the narrative styles match the texts well and have theatrical polish. Releases this fall include BEATRIX POTTER STORIES, A CHILD'S GARDEN OF VERSES and BEST LOVED POEMS (Longfellow, Whitman, Kipling and others). R.F.W. (c)AudioFile, Portland, Maine
